Role Description

We are seeking a Senior Embedded Software Engineer for a full-time, on-site role in Long Island. In this position, you will design, develop, and test embedded software solutions as part of a multidisciplinary team. Your day-to-day responsibilities will include writing and optimizing embedded code, debugging software, and contributing to scalable software design. Collaborating with cross-functional teams, you will play a key role in driving the development and success of innovative products.

Required Qualifications

  • Requires a Bachelor or Master of Science in Computer Engineering or Electrical Engineering
  • 7+ years of experience
  • Extensive experience with microcontrollers, including ARM-based platforms like STM32 and NXP, and AVR, DSP, and PIC devices.
  • Proficiency in embedded C programming for microcontroller-based systems
  • Experience developing bare-metal or RTOS-based firmware
  • Experience with BLE and Bluetooth‑based IoT communication protocols
  • Knowledge of IoT communication protocols such as Wi-Fi, Zigbee, and 4G/5G cellular
  • Experience developing firmware for low‑power, battery‑operated systems
  • Ability to design low‑level software and perform firmware verification, analysis, and optimization
  • Experience with microcontroller interfaces: I²C, SPI, GPIO, ADC, CAN, and UART.
  • Ability to read schematics and understand component data sheets
  • Experience troubleshooting and debugging using o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, and related tools
